About This Item
Philip Lee Warner, Publisher to the Medici Society, Limited 7 Grafton St. London, W, 1. 1917. 1917. 4to. Cloth spine to blue boards. Limited edition stated on Vol I, II, III. volumes 4 & 5 are identical, but no limited edition statement. Printed on rag paper. Volume I has a foxed cover, with tape marks around the edges of the front and rear board. All volumes have bumped extremes, un-cut page edges, foxing to end pages, however the copies are bright and unmarked. Vol 1 & 2 have po name on fep. .
